*,:after,:before{box-sizing:border-box}body,html{height:100%;color:#fff;font-size:16px;font-weight:400;line-height:120%;background:#2a2e30;scroll-behavior:smooth}@media screen and (min-width:640px){body,html{font-size:calc(12px + .2083333333vw)}}body>#__next{min-height:100%;height:100%;display:flex;flex-direction:column}main{flex:1 1 auto}a{color:#fff;text-decoration:none;transition:color .3s cubic-bezier(.4,0,.2,1);outline:none}a:focus-visible,a:hover{color:#cbae90}a:focus-visible{outline:2px solid #cbae90;border-radius:4px}button,input,optgroup,select,textarea{margin:0;font-family:inherit;font-size:inherit;line-height:inherit;-webkit-appearance:none}body,p{margin:0}@media screen and (min-width:1025px){*{scrollbar-width:thin;scrollbar-color:#cbae90 #2a2e30}::-webkit-scrollbar{width:10px}::-webkit-scrollbar-track{background:#2a2e30}::-webkit-scrollbar-thumb{background-color:#cbae90;border-radius:30px;border:2px solid hsla(31,36%,68%,.4)}}@media screen and (min-width:300px)and (max-width:1000px)and (max-height:450px){header.header__select-apartments{display:none}}.footer__select-apartments{display:none}@media screen and (min-width:1280px){.footer__select-apartments{display:block}}.column{display:grid;grid-auto-flow:column}.row{display:grid;grid-auto-flow:row}.LoadingScreen_container__3OepZ{padding-top:92px;height:clamp(696px,100vh,1555px);padding-bottom:30px;animation:LoadingScreen_fadeOut__JwJ__ 1s ease-in-out 1s forwards;position:fixed;z-index:999;width:100%;background:#2a2e30}@media screen and (min-width:640px){.LoadingScreen_container__3OepZ{padding-top:120px}}@media screen and (min-width:1280px){.LoadingScreen_container__3OepZ{padding-top:140px}}@media screen and (min-width:300px)and (max-width:1000px)and (max-height:450px){.LoadingScreen_container__3OepZ{padding-top:92px}}@media screen and (min-width:1024px){.LoadingScreen_container__3OepZ{width:100%;max-width:1920px;margin-left:auto;margin-right:auto;padding-left:20px;padding-right:20px;max-width:none}}@media screen and (min-width:1024px)and (min-width:768px){.LoadingScreen_container__3OepZ{padding-left:25px;padding-right:25px}}@media screen and (min-width:1024px)and (min-width:3840px){.LoadingScreen_container__3OepZ{max-width:2560px}}@media screen and (min-width:3840px){.LoadingScreen_container__3OepZ{height:100vh;max-width:none}}.LoadingScreen_wrapper__SZJyq{position:relative;height:100%;width:100%;border-radius:20px;overflow:hidden;display:flex;align-items:center;justify-content:center}@media screen and (min-width:640px){.LoadingScreen_wrapper__SZJyq{border-radius:40px}}.LoadingScreen_loadingScreen__K0XV_{object-fit:cover;width:calc(100% - 40px)!important;margin:0 auto;border-radius:20px}@media screen and (min-width:640px){.LoadingScreen_loadingScreen__K0XV_{width:calc(100% - 60px)!important;border-radius:40px}}@media screen and (min-width:1024px){.LoadingScreen_loadingScreen__K0XV_{padding:0;width:100%!important}}@media screen and (min-width:3840px){.LoadingScreen_loadingScreen__K0XV_{object-fit:contain}}.LoadingScreen_logo__ym9NC{object-fit:contain;aspect-ratio:830/210;width:44%!important;top:auto!important;bottom:auto!important;left:auto!important;right:auto!important}@keyframes LoadingScreen_fadeOut__JwJ__{0%{opacity:1}to{opacity:0}}@font-face{font-family:__geologica_1e967a;src:url(/_next/static/media/c38490135f5dc9ef-s.p.woff2) format("woff2");font-display:swap}@font-face{font-family:__geologica_Fallback_1e967a;src:local("Arial");ascent-override:94.62%;descent-override:26.69%;line-gap-override:0.00%;size-adjust:103.04%}.__className_1e967a{font-family:__geologica_1e967a,__geologica_Fallback_1e967a}